Thomas O'Connell

  • Thomas O'Connell is a Texas prosecutor who successfully won a murder conviction and death sentence against Charles Dean Hood in 1990. Hood was scheduled to be executed on September 10, 2008, but his execution was stayed after his lawyers alleged that the judge in his trial, Verla Sue Holland, had engaged in an extramarital affair with O'Connell. In depositions, both Holland and O'Connell admitted to the affair.The New York Times: Judge and Prosecutor Admit to Affair, Lawyer Says (September 9, 2008)
  • The Affair

    Holland allegedly engaged in the affair while she was married to the late Earl Holland. Many legal ethicists say that Holland or O'Connell should have recused themselves from the case.Salon: Ardor in the Court (June 24, 2005)
